Output 84d1b95e09afd44c4c803b7ca1e71550a8023f3e16a1eaa75ff2a9c427274306:0

value
10252878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dedb76e9e12bb3e02aa8ca95cb0daf6325bea6 OP_EQUAL
address
37stAntAwzBFZJwCZWXmrY8Ho94xekaX9f
transaction
84d1b95e09afd44c4c803b7ca1e71550a8023f3e16a1eaa75ff2a9c427274306
confirmations
207788
spent
true